The concept of positive thinking is not rocket science – it refers to the process of thinking confidently about oneself, one's circumstances, and one's environment. It involves adopting a hopeful attitude, reframing negative thoughts, and focusing on answers rather than obstacles. Positive thinking has been linked to a range of benefits, including improved mood.
One of the most significant findings in the field of positive thinking is its impact on the body's defense system. Research has shown that people who practice positive thinking have a stronger immune system, which enables them to fight off diseases more successfully. Studies have also found that positive thinking can reduce the severity of chronic illnesses such as HIV.
In addition to its physical benefits, 津市 整体 positive thinking also has a significant impact on mental health. It has been linked to reduced symptoms of anxiety and depression. Positive thinking can also improve social connections, which are important for overall well-being.
So, how can we cultivate a positive mindset in our daily lives? One of the most useful ways is through mindful exercise. Mindfulness involves paying focus to the present moment, without criticism. Regular meditation practice can increase feelings of calm and well-being.
Another way to cultivate positive thinking is through the practice of thankfulness. Focusing on the things we are thankful for can help improve our outlook. We can start by keeping a thankfulness log, where we write down three things we are thankful for each day.
